首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

增强查询为另一查询的每一列合并/添加文件中的行

增强查询是一种将两个查询结果合并或添加行的操作。它可以通过将两个查询的结果按照某个共同的列进行匹配,然后将它们的列合并或添加到一个新的结果集中。

增强查询的优势在于可以方便地将不同的查询结果进行整合,从而得到更全面和丰富的数据。它可以用于数据分析、报表生成、数据集成等场景。

在云计算领域,腾讯云提供了一系列相关产品和服务来支持增强查询的需求。其中,腾讯云数据库(TencentDB)是一种高性能、可扩展的云数据库服务,支持增强查询功能。用户可以通过腾讯云数据库的联合查询、子查询、视图等功能来实现增强查询操作。

此外,腾讯云还提供了云原生数据库TDSQL、分布式数据库TBase、数据仓库CDW等产品,它们都具备强大的查询和数据处理能力,可以满足不同规模和复杂度的增强查询需求。

更多关于腾讯云数据库产品的详细介绍和使用指南,可以参考腾讯云官方文档:腾讯云数据库产品介绍

总结:增强查询是一种将两个查询结果合并或添加行的操作,可以通过腾讯云数据库等产品来实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HIVE基础命令Sqoop导入导出插入表问题动态分区表创建HIVE表脚本筛选CSV文件GROUP BYSqoop导出到MySQL字段类型问题WHERE查询CASE查询

和数据导入相关 Hive数据导入表情况: 在load data时,如果加载文件在HDFS上,此文件会被移动到表路径; 在load data时,如果加载文件在本地,此文件会被复制到HDFS表路径...finally: connection.close() getTotalSQL() 筛选CSV文件 AND CAST( regexp_replace (sour_t.check_line_id...WHERE查询 在hive查询会有各种问题,这里解决方法是将子查询改成JOIN方式 先看一段在MySQLSQL,下不管这段SQL从哪来,我也不知道从哪里来 SELECT...toString() : this.name; } } 在 JOIN/LEFT JOIN/RIGHT JOIN之后,添加 AND 条件 如果有 UNION/UNION ALL操作, 添加...CASE查询 这个与上面是一样,都是改成JOIN方式。

15.3K20

2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。 你可以选定连续若干组成防风带,防风带一列防风高度一列最大值

2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。...你可以选定连续若干组成防风带,防风带一列防风高度一列最大值 防风带整体防风高度,所有列防风高度最小值。...比如,假设选定如下三 1 5 4 7 2 6 2 3 4 1、7、2列,防风高度7 5、2、3列,防风高度5 4、6、4列,防风高度6 防风带整体防风高度5,是7、5、6最小值 给定一个正数...k,k <= matrix行数,表示可以取连续k,这k一起防风。...求防风带整体防风高度最大值。 答案2022-09-25: 窗口内最大值和最小值问题。 代码用rust编写。

2.6K10

数据系统读写权衡一知半解

是否应该对一列都建立索引?什么时候应该把一列数据编入索引?我索引越多,读取查询就会变得越快。同时,索引越多,数据更新速度就越慢。 这是一个常见权衡方案,快速读意味着慢速写。...存储与列存储 将高性能更新与存储联系起来是很自然,如果按列组织数据的话,因为具有相同值许多逻辑行在物理上彼此相近,柱状数据库执行查询速度非常快。但是,更新列存储就不那么容易了。...通常,存储更新单独保存,因为数据较小,查询会以相对快速方式检查。这些查询与更快列存储结果相结合,以提供统一准确结果。...新存储更新会定期与列存储合并,以创建新列存储,这可以以类似于 LSM 树合并级联方式完成。...因此,在越来越受欢迎 LSM 结构,有各种各样实现选择: 平衡合并 当一个新文件添加到一个级别时,在循环遍历中选择下一个文件,并将其与下一个级别的文件合并

61620

PostgreSQL 教程

排序 指导您如何对查询返回结果集进行排序。 去重查询 您提供一个删除结果集中重复子句。 第 2 节. 过滤数据 主题 描述 WHERE 根据指定条件过滤。...完全外连接 使用完全连接查找一个表另一个表没有匹配。 交叉连接 生成两个或多个表笛卡尔积。 自然连接 根据连接表公共列名称,使用隐式连接条件连接两个或多个表。 第 4 节....连接删除 根据另一个表值删除表。 UPSERT 如果新已存在于表,则插入或更新数据。 第 10 节....重命名表 将表名称更改为新名称。 添加列 向您展示如何向现有表添加一列或多列。 删除列 演示如何删除表列。 更改列数据类型 向您展示如何更改列数据。 重命名列 说明如何重命名表一列或多列。...检查约束 添加逻辑以基于布尔表达式检查值。 唯一约束 确保一列或一组列值在整个表是唯一。 非空约束 确保列值不是NULL。 第 14 节.

49410

Power Query 真经 - 第 8 章 - 纵向追加数据

然后扫描第二个(和后续)查询标题。如果任何标题不存在于现有列,新列将被添加。然后,它将适当记录填入每个数据集一列,用 “null” 值填补所有空白。...另一方面,由于源文件列名改变了,“Mar 2008” 查询没有 “Date” 列,而是拥有 “TranDate” 列。...这个功能被称为扩展操作,最有价值地方是,因为 “Name” 适用于表 “Content” 列,展开后它将与此前对应相关联。 按如下所示进行操作。...此时已经成功地创建了一个从工作表读取数据 “黑科技”,在 “打印区域” 读取一列,如图 8-25 所示。...至此,已经探索了用外部数据源手动追加,以及如何为工作簿数据生成自动更新系统,有没有可能把这些合并起来,创建一个系统,可以推广到合并一个文件所有文件,而不必在 Power Query 手动添加每个文件

6.6K30

一文读懂 HBase 核心原理与应用场景

每一次刷写磁盘都会生成新HFile文件。可以参考如下原理图: ?...随着时间推移,写入HFile会越来越多,查询数据时就会因为要进行多次io导致性能降低,为了提升读性能,HBase会定期执行compaction操作以合并HFile。...前面也提到了,HBase一列数据在底层都是以 KV 形式存储,而针对一数据,同一列不同列数据是顺序相邻存放,这种模式实际上是式存储;而如果一个列族下只有一个列的话,就是一种列式存储。...HBase提供二级索引能力,还扮演着HBaseSQL层,增强了HBase即席查询能力。...所以,我们一般在HBase之上架设Phoenix或Spark等组件,增强HBase数据分析处理能力。

2K31

Power Query 真经 - 第 10 章 - 横向合并数据

现在需要做是先为这两个数据表各创建一个 “暂存” 查询。 创建一个新查询,连接到 “第 10 章 示例文件 / Merging Basics.xlsx” 文件两个表。...【注意】 每次创建正确【右反】连接时,连接结果将显示一空值,并在最后一列显示一个嵌套表。这是意料之中,因为左表没有匹配项,导致空。...转到【添加列】【自定义列】。 将列名设置 “MergeKey” 列,公式 “= 1”【确定】。 将查询加载【仅限连接】查询。...由于客户尚未达到 5,000 件单价点,因此单价需要退回达到 2,500 单价层 5.65 美元价格。 【注意】 用户还会注意到,在上面的图片中,作者仔细地标记了数据下方一列。...创建 Excel 或 DAX 公式,以计算异常表未知项目(数量,并将其返回到报表页面,以便于查看(每次刷新时,将能够看到未知项计数是否 0 ,或者转换表是否需要添加其他项)。

4.1K20

《SQL开发样式指南》,让你SQL代码更加规范

_size 大小,如文件大小或服装大小。...Identation 缩进 确保SQL可读性,一定要遵守下列规则。 Joins Join语句 Join语句应该缩进到川流另一侧并在必要时候添加一个换行。...Subqueries 子查询查询应该在川流右侧对齐并使用其他查询相同样式。有时候将右括号单独置于一并同与它配对左括号对齐是有意义——尤其是当存在嵌套子查询时候。...所以列定义顺序和分组一定要有意义。 在CREATE定义列要缩进4个空格。...将值存入一列并将单位存在另一列。列定义应该让自己单位不言自明以避免在应用内进行合并。使用CHECK()来保证数据库数据是合法

13810

基于Excel2013PowerQuery入门

导入一店数据2.png 点击加载,一店.xlsx这个文件数据会被导入到工作薄查询。 ? 工作簿查询.png 用相同方法加载下载文件二店.xlsx文件,结果图示如下。 ?...成功修整.png 合并期间选择多列时候,要先选择姓名.1那一列,再选择姓名.2 ? 合并列1.png ? 合并列2.png ? 成功合并.png ? 拆分列1.png ?...成功加载.png 4.数据拆分合并提取 打开下载文件04-数据拆分合并提取.xlsx,如下图所示。 ? 打开文件图示.png ? 加载至查询编辑器.png ?...加载数据至查询编辑器.png 选定日期这一列,将数据类型改为整数。 ? image.png ? 删除错误.png ?...成功分组结果.png 10.添加列 打开下载文件10-添加列.xlsx,如下图所示。 ? 打开文件图示.png ? 进行分组操作.png ? 逆序排序.png ? 添加索引列.png ?

9.9K50

Mysql 复习总结

左连接 右连接 内连接  把两次或者多次查询结果合并在一起  要求:两次查询列数一致  推荐:查询一列列类型一致   select * from ta   ...new 来表示 一列值 用 new.列名来表示 对于 insert 删除用 old 来表示 一列值 用 old.列名来表示 对于 update 修改前用 old...来表示 修改后用 new  一列值 用 old.列名来表示 清空表 truncate 表名;  事务  start transaction  sql语句  commit...库名 库名 >地址/文件名.sql #导出所有库 mysqldump -u 用户名 -p 密码  -A >地址/文件名.sql 恢复 #以库单位 source <地址/文件名.sql...#以表单位 use database 再  source <地址/文件名.sql 索引  # 原则    不要过度索引    索引条件 查询(where)比较频繁时候

71020

文本处理,第2部分:OH,倒排索引

促进因素有效地增加了有效影响文件或领域重要性词频。可以通过以下方式之一将文档添加到索引; 插入,修改和删除。通常情况下,文档将首先添加到内存缓冲区,内存缓冲区组织RAM倒排索引。...另一方面,IDF值将是段文件每个发布列表相应IDF总和(如果同一文档已更新,则该值稍微偏离,但这种差异可忽略不计)。但是,合并多个段文件处理会导致文档检索处理开销。...分布式索引是由Lucene构建其他技术提供,例如ElasticSearch。典型设置如下...在此设置,机器按列和组织。列表示文档分区,而每行表示整个语料库副本。...然后客户端查询将被广播到选定一列机器。每台机器将在其本地索引执行搜索,并将TopM元素返回给查询处理器,该查询处理器将在返回给客户端之前合并结果。...不做更改:在这里我们假设文档均匀分布在不同分区上,所以本地IDF代表了实际IDF一个很好比例。 额外:在第一轮查询被广播到返回其本地IDF一列

2.1K40

【ClickHouse 极简教程-图文详解原理系列】ClickHouse 主键索引存储结构与查询性能优化

一列都有一个bin文件和mrk文件,其中bin文件是实际数据存储 primary.idx存储主键信息,结构与mrk一样,类似于一个稀疏索引。...通过再添加一列c:(a, b, c)仅在同时符合两个条件时才有意义: 如果您对此列有过滤器查询;- 在您数据,具有相同值数据范围 可能相当长(比 大几倍) 。...换句话说,当再添加一列时,将允许跳过足够大数据范围。index_granularity``(a, b) 2. 数据按主键排序。这样数据更可压缩。有时,通过在主键添加一列可以更好地压缩数据。...同时,对于一列,都有带有标记 column.mrk 文件,该文件记录是每个第 N 行在数据文件偏移量。...ClickHouse 不适用于高负载简单点查询,因为对于每一个键,整个 index_granularity 范围数据都需要读取,并且对于一列需要解压缩整个压缩块。

2.9K30

简单谈谈OLTP,OLAP和列存储概念

这里以零售数据仓库例: 模式中心是一个所谓事实表,在本例fact_sales表,事实表表示在特定时间发生事件,这里代表客户购买一个商品。...这是因为列按照相同顺序包含,因此一列位图中第 k 位和另一列位图中第 k 位对应相同。...注意,对列分别执行排序是没有意义,因为那样就没法知道不同列哪些项属于同一。我们只能在明确一列第 k 项与另一列第 k 项属于同一情况下,才能重建出完整。...但最大区别在于面向存储将保存在一个地方(在堆文件或聚集索引),次级索引只包含指向匹配指针。在列式存储,通常在其他地方没有任何指向数据指针,只有包含值列。...内存存储是面向还是列并不重要。当已经积累了足够写入数据时,它们将与硬盘上文件合并,并批量写入新文件。这基本上是 Vertica 所做

3.4K31

架构探索之ClickHouse

,资源浪费 列式存储 将一列单独存储,按需读取 hbase 适合列使用单一业务 3.2 架构 通过以上推导分析,我们可以得出OLAP查询瓶颈在于磁盘IO,那么ck优化手段也是借鉴了以上措施,...因为一列单独存储,因此每个数据文件相比于式存储更有规律,通过对block采用LZ4压缩算法,整体压缩比大致可以8:1。...=0或1文件合并,并标记删除,后续物理删除 3.2.4 索引 ClickHouse采用一级索引(稀疏索引)+二级索引(跳数索引)来实现索引数据定位与查询。...如上述介绍,一个block块8192,那么1亿条数据只需要1万索引,所以一级索引占用存储较小,可常驻内存,加速查询。...如上述讲列存、批处理、预排序等等。但是架构都有两面性,从一另方面也带来了一些缺点。 •高频次实时写入方面,因ck会将批量数据直接落盘成小文件,高频写入会造成大量小文件生成与合并,影响查询性能。

24410

《数据密集型应用系统设计》读书笔记(三)

由于片段在写入后不可修改(只会追加),所以合并片段会被写入另一个新文件。...最常见多列索引类型称为「级联索引」(concatenated index),它通过将一列追加到另一列,将几个字段简单地组合成一个键(索引定义指定字段连接顺序)。...个不同值列转化为 个单独位图,每个位图对应一个不同值,其中一个位对应为一,如果具有该值,则该位 1,否则为 0(相当于把一列具体数值变成了一坨仅包含 0 或 1 文件)。...对于列存储来说,这与面向存储多个二级索引类似,最大区别在于,面向存储将都保存在一个位置(在堆文件或聚集索引),二级索引只包含匹配指针;而对于列存储,通常没有任何指向别处数据指针...内存存储可以是面向或面向列(不重要),当积累了足够写入时,它们将与磁盘上文件合并,并批量写入新文件

1K50

Hive3查询基础知识

[WHERE expression]; 根据可选WHERE子句中指定条件,UPDATE语句可能会影响表。WHERE子句中表达式必须是Hive SELECT子句支持表达式。...• 带有隐含GROUP BY语句相关子查询可能仅返回一。 • 子查询对列所有不合格引用都必须解析查询表。 • 相关子查询不能包含窗口子句。...您可以查询一个表相对于另一数据。...相关查询包含带有等于(=)运算符查询谓词。运算符一侧必须引用父查询至少一列,而另一侧必须引用子查询至少一列。不相关查询不会引用父查询任何列。...您已在hive-site.xml文件中将以下参数设置column,以启用带引号标识符: 在hive-site.xml 文件中将hive.support.quoted.identifiers 配置参数设置

4.6K20

PySpark︱DataFrame操作指南:增删改查合并统计与数据处理

**查询总行数:** 取别名 **查询某列为null:** **输出list类型,list每个元素是Row类:** 查询概况 去重set操作 随机抽样 --- 1.2 列元素操作 --- **获取...(参考:王强知乎回复) pythonlist不能直接添加到dataframe,需要先将list转为新dataframe,然后新dataframe和老dataframe进行join操作,...,一列分组组名,另一列总数 max(*cols) —— 计算每组中一列或多列最大值 mean(*cols) —— 计算每组中一列或多列平均值 min(*cols) ——...计算每组中一列或多列最小值 sum(*cols) —— 计算每组中一列或多列总和 — 4.3 apply 函数 — 将df一列应用函数f: df.foreach(f) 或者 df.rdd.foreach...df = df.dropna(subset=['col_name1', 'col_name2']) # 扔掉col1或col2任一一列包含na ex: train.dropna().count

30.1K10

mysql小结(1) MYSQL索引特性小结

,当用户查询一个范围结果时,另一个事务执行了相应插入删除操作,导致两次查询结果不同,少了或多了一些,就像幻象一样。...当联合索引一列查询频率都相差不多时,可以优先将选择率最高列作为联合索引第一列,这样第一列即可过滤更多列,效率更高。...简单说,幻读指当用户读取某一范围数据行时,另一个事务又在该范围内插入了新,当用户再读取该范围数据行时,会发现有新“幻影” 。...index_merge:查询同时使用两个(或更多)索引,然后对索引结果进行合并(merge),再读取表数据。...Rows:MySQL Query Optimizer 通过系统收集统计信息估算出来结果集记录条数。 Extra:查询一步实现额外细节信息,主要会是以下内容。

1.1K30

MySQL(联合查询、子查询、分页查询

目录 联合查询查询 分页查询 联合查询 联合查询是指将多个查询结果合并成一个结果集(二维表),通常出现在统计分析。 语法: 查询语句1 UNION 查询语句2 UNION ......查询语句N 注意: 1.所有查询语句返回结果列数必须相等 2.数据类型必须一致,【查询语句1字段列表类型必须和查询语句2字段列表类型对应且一致】 代码实例: SELECT user_id...子查询分类: 按结果及行数分: 1、 标量子查询(单行子查询:结果集只有一一列) 2、 列子查询(多行子查询:结果集多行一列) 3、 查询(结果集有多行多列) 4、 表子查询(结果集有多行多列)...WHERE user_id NOT IN(SELECT user_id FROM b_order); ANY|SOME t1有5条记录,s1去和(select s1 from t2)...t1有5条记录,s1去和(select s1 from t2)s1去比较,必须t1s1大于t2所有的s1,那么当前行满足查询条件 SELECT s1 FROM t1 WHERE

16.3K20

ClickHouse(09)ClickHouse合并树MergeTree家族表引擎之MergeTree详细解析

在Wide格式下,一列都会在文件系统存储单独文件,在Compact格式下所有列都存储在一个文件。Compact格式可以提高插入量少插入频率频繁时性能。...每个颗粒第一通过该行主键值进行标记,ClickHouse会为每个数据片段创建一个索引文件来存储这些标记。对于列,无论它是否包含在主键当中,ClickHouse都会存储类似标记。...如果当前主键是 (a, b) ,在下列情况下添加另一个 c 列会提升性能: 查询会使用 c 列作为条件 很长数据范围(index_granularity数倍)里(a, b)都是相同值,并且这样情况很普遍...换言之,就是加入另一列后,可以让您查询略过很长数据范围。 改善数据压缩。ClickHouse以主键排序片段数据,所以,数据一致性越高,压缩越好。...列x包含每组最大值,y最小值,d可能任意值。

69310
领券